About this school

The Acorns Primary and Nursery School is a primary academy in Ellesmere Port. It teaches children aged 2 to 11 and has 356 pupils on roll.

Ofsted has inspected The Acorns Primary and Nursery School, and its latest judgement is set out below. Where the Department for Education has published them, its results and pupil characteristics appear below. Seeing a school for yourself shows what no page can, so arrange a visit before you apply.

Ofsted judgement

England: previous inspection framework
Inspected 11 June 2025 · short inspection

Ofsted's most recent visit was a short inspection on 11 June 2025, where inspectors found that standards have been maintained. The school's last full inspection took place before September 2019, so its area grades are not part of Ofsted's current published data. Older reports are on the school's Ofsted page.

Exam results

Key stage 2 (end of primary school)

Measure 2022/23 2023/24 2024/25
Pupils at the end of key stage 2 36 44 45
Met the expected standard in reading, writing and maths 47% 39% 56%
Reached the higher standard in reading, writing and maths 0% 5% 7%
Expected standard in reading 61% 66% 64%
Expected standard in maths 75% 50% 64%
Expected standard in grammar, punctuation and spelling 64% 61% 62%
Average scaled score in reading 102.0 103.0 106.0
Average scaled score in maths 103.0 100.0 104.0
Reading progress +0.10 - -
Writing progress +3.10 - -
Maths progress +1.80 - -

Progress measures ended nationally after the 2022/23 school year, when the key stage 1 assessments they were based on were stopped. Blank progress figures in later years are not missing school data.

How The Acorns Primary and Nursery School compares

The Acorns Primary and Nursery School ranked 73rd of 116 primary schools in Cheshire West and Chester for KS2 results in 2024/25. Its KS2 result was higher than 31% of England primary schools that published results in 2024/25. Its absence rate was lower than 43% of England schools in 2024/25.

School KS2 RWM (2024/25) Absence FSM (6 years) Pupils Distance
This school 56% 5.8% 52.8% 356
Brookside Primary School 50% 6.8% 42.1% 184 0.5 miles
William Stockton Community Primary School 63% 5.7% 44.2% 367 0.6 miles
Our Lady Star of the Sea Catholic Primary School 62% 5.5% 27% 290 0.7 miles
Rivacre Valley Primary School 58% 8.2% 36.2% 339 0.7 miles
Westminster Community Primary School 61% 5.8% 52.4% 151 0.7 miles

Results reflect each school's cohort as much as its teaching, and free school meals share is context, not a judgement. Small gaps between neighbouring schools are rarely meaningful on their own.

Is The Acorns Primary and Nursery School full?
The Acorns Primary and Nursery School has capacity for 394 pupils and 356 on roll (90%), so it has space against its published capacity. Places are allocated through the local authority's admissions process, so capacity alone does not tell you whether a place is available.
